Lines Matching refs:bsf

43     AVBSFContext *bsf = NULL;  in LLVMFuzzerTestOneInput()  local
61 res = av_bsf_alloc(f, &bsf); in LLVMFuzzerTestOneInput()
70 bsf->par_in->width = bytestream2_get_le32(&gbc); in LLVMFuzzerTestOneInput()
71 bsf->par_in->height = bytestream2_get_le32(&gbc); in LLVMFuzzerTestOneInput()
72 bsf->par_in->bit_rate = bytestream2_get_le64(&gbc); in LLVMFuzzerTestOneInput()
73 bsf->par_in->bits_per_coded_sample = bytestream2_get_le32(&gbc); in LLVMFuzzerTestOneInput()
79 bsf->par_in->codec_id = id; in LLVMFuzzerTestOneInput()
80 bsf->par_in->codec_tag = bytestream2_get_le32(&gbc); in LLVMFuzzerTestOneInput()
85 bsf->par_in->sample_rate = bytestream2_get_le32(&gbc); in LLVMFuzzerTestOneInput()
86bsf->par_in->channels = (unsigned)bytestream2_get_le32(&gbc) % FF_SANE_NB_CHANNE… in LLVMFuzzerTestOneInput()
87 bsf->par_in->block_align = bytestream2_get_le32(&gbc); in LLVMFuzzerTestOneInput()
91 bsf->par_in->extradata = av_mallocz(extradata_size + AV_INPUT_BUFFER_PADDING_SIZE); in LLVMFuzzerTestOneInput()
92 if (bsf->par_in->extradata) { in LLVMFuzzerTestOneInput()
93 bsf->par_in->extradata_size = extradata_size; in LLVMFuzzerTestOneInput()
94 size -= bsf->par_in->extradata_size; in LLVMFuzzerTestOneInput()
95 memcpy(bsf->par_in->extradata, data + size, bsf->par_in->extradata_size); in LLVMFuzzerTestOneInput()
98 if (av_image_check_size(bsf->par_in->width, bsf->par_in->height, 0, bsf)) in LLVMFuzzerTestOneInput()
99 bsf->par_in->width = bsf->par_in->height = 0; in LLVMFuzzerTestOneInput()
102 res = av_bsf_init(bsf); in LLVMFuzzerTestOneInput()
104 av_bsf_free(&bsf); in LLVMFuzzerTestOneInput()
132 res = av_bsf_send_packet(bsf, &in); in LLVMFuzzerTestOneInput()
135 res = av_bsf_receive_packet(bsf, &out); in LLVMFuzzerTestOneInput()
143 res = av_bsf_send_packet(bsf, NULL); in LLVMFuzzerTestOneInput()
145 res = av_bsf_receive_packet(bsf, &out); in LLVMFuzzerTestOneInput()
151 av_bsf_free(&bsf); in LLVMFuzzerTestOneInput()